SHAW v. HUNTER

No. 2053.

15 F.Supp. 328 (1936)

SHAW v. HUNTER et al.

District Court, N. D. Oklahoma.

June 26, 1936.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

F. C. Swindell, of Tulsa Okl., for plaintiff.

F. B. Dillard, of Tulsa, Okl., for defendants.


KENNAMER, District Judge.

This is an action to recover from the sureties on the bond of C. R. Hunter, executor of the estate of H. E. Brooks, deceased, appointed by the county court of Tulsa county, Okl., sitting in probate. An accounting was had in the county court and Hunter was adjudged to be indebted to the estate in the amount of several thousand dollars. O. S.
